Once you see more substantial furnishings made from rubberwood (for instance a desk or dining table), chances are you'll recognize several parallel strains across only one wood piece. It Practically appears to be like just as if you can find numerous parts fused jointly. This is termed a finger-joint board, which glues and interlocks many solid, smaller sized lumber elements into a larger solitary piece alongside zig-zag "finger" joints.

 Cover and trunk, Thailand Hevea brasiliensis is actually a tall deciduous tree increasing to the height of approximately forty three m (141 ft) within the wild. Cultivated trees usually are A lot more compact because drawing from the latex restricts their growth. The trunk is cylindrical and could have a swollen, bottle-formed base.
